On Thu, 26 Sep 2013 18:21:46 -0500, Spenser Gilliland wrote:
> --- a/package/x11r7/xlib_libpthread-stubs/Config.in
> +++ b/package/libpthread-stubs/Config.in
> @@ -1,4 +1,4 @@
> -config BR2_PACKAGE_XLIB_LIBPTHREAD_STUBS
> +config BR2_PACKAGE_LIBPTHREAD_STUBS
This renaming of option should lead to additions to the
Config.in.legacy file.
I think the move makes sense since libpthread-stubs is not part of the
X.org releases (see http://www.x.org/releases/X11R7.7/src/everything/).
